Transaction 59ee25e773332f6f035abbd4cd4a21ffa81b5b6f9809a29398e564f5713b3f26
1 Input
1 Output
-
59ee25e773332f6f035abbd4cd4a21ffa81b5b6f9809a29398e564f5713b3f26: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d62647682dedc3597e8d6dfb64513445e0ec3c9a67384e965bef3ac831641351
- address
- bc1p6cnyw6pdahp4jl5ddhakg5f5ghswc0y6vuuya9jmauavsvtyzdgs4swfem